MSNBC is canceling Joy Reid’s program "The ReidOut" as part of a new network shakeup. Reid will host her final episode later this week, Fox News Digital reports.
The decision to boot Reid off the air comes as the network has lost around half of its viewers since the election, is undergoing a leadership change at the top and will be spun off from NBC News.
Specifically, no show on MSNBC has suffered more since the election of Donald Trump than Reid's has. Since Nov 5, her program has lost around 53% of its viewers in the advertiser-covered demographic of adults aged 25–54.
